香香了,3280多頁實戰pdf集合:Redis+多執行緒+Nginx+JVM+中介軟體+MySQL

2020-11-12 21:00:21

寫在前面

作為一名Java開發者,在現在這個資訊化時代很快的時代,很少會有人停下腳步去思考以及去總結,忽略了很重要的一個步驟,沒有反思和總結,只會用原來固有的想法去做事情,所以還是需要隔一段時間去總結。LZ今天總結了自己在平時會用到的一些:

01—Redis實戰

在Redis誕生數年之後的今天,這個專案已經發生了顯著的變化:我們現在擁有了一個更為健壯的系統,並且隨著Redis 2.6的釋出,開發的重點已經轉移到實現叢集以及高可用特性上面,Redis正在進入它的成熟期。在我看來,Redis 生態系統中進步最為明顯的一個地方,就是redis.io網站以及Redis Google Group這些由使用者和貢獻者組成的社群。數以千計的人通過GitHub的問題反饋系統參與到了這個專案裡面,他們為Redis編寫使用者端庫、提交修補程式並幫助其他遇到麻煩的使用者。

時至今日, Redis 仍然是一一個BSD授權的社群專案,它沒有那些需要付錢才能使用的閉源外掛或者功能增強版。Redis 的參考檔案非常詳細和準確,在遇到問題時也很容易就可以找到Redis開發者或者專家來為你排憂解難。

pdf的目錄大綱介紹:

第一部分入門

  • 第1章初識Redis
  • 第2章使用Redis構建Web應用

第二部分核心概念

  • 第3章Redis命令
  • 第4章資料安全與效能保障
  • 第5章使用Redis構建支援程式
  • 第6章使用Redis構建應用程式元件
  • 第7章基於搜尋的應用程式
  • 第8章構建簡單的社群網站

第三部分進階內容

  • 第9章降低記憶體佔用
  • 第10章擴充套件Redis
  • 第11章Redis的Lua指令碼程式設計

愛了,3174頁實戰pdf集錦:Redis+多執行緒+Dubbo+JVM+kafka+MySQL

 

02—Java多執行緒程式設計核心技術

結合大量範例,全面講解Java多執行緒程式設計中的並行存取、執行緒間通訊、鎖等最難突破的核心技術與應用實踐。

pdf的目錄大綱介紹:

  • 第1章Java多執行緒技能
  • 第2章物件及變數的並行存取!
  • 第3章執行緒間通訊
  • 第4章Lock的使用
  • 第5章定時器Timer
  • 第6章單例模式與多執行緒
  • 第7章拾遺增補

愛了,3174頁實戰pdf集錦:Redis+多執行緒+Dubbo+JVM+kafka+MySQL

03—深入理解Apache Dubbo與實戰

隨著業務規模的發展和複雜度的增加,傳統的單體應用已經很難適應業務迭代的訴求,越來越多的公司開始進行服務化的改造。很高興看到Apache Dubbo被許多公司採用,作為服務化改造的基礎架構進行演進。這裡面就包括了許多網際網路公司、國字頭的大型企業,以及金融行業的巨頭公司。

PDF主要目錄大綱介紹:

  • 第1章Dubbo高效能RPC通訊框架
  • 第2章開發第一款Dubbo 應用程式
  • 第3章Dubbo註冊中心
  • 第4章Dubbo擴充套件點載入機制
  • 第5章Dubbo啟停原理解析
  • 第6章Dubbo遠端呼叫
  • 第7章Dubbo叢集容錯
  • 第8章Dubbo擴充套件點
  • 第9章Dubbo高階特性
  • 第10章Dubbo過濾器
  • 第11章Dubbo註冊中心擴充套件實踐
  • 第12章Dubbo服務治理平臺
  • 第13章Dubbo未來展望

愛了,3174頁實戰pdf集錦:Redis+多執行緒+Dubbo+JVM+kafka+MySQL

 

 

04—揭祕Java虛擬機器器:JVM設計原理與實現

JVM作為一款虛擬機器器,本身便是技術之集大成者,裡面包含方方面面的底層技術知識。拋開如今Java 如日中天之態勢不說,純粹從技術層面看, JVM也值得廣大技術愛好者深入研究。可以說,從最新的硬體特性,到最新的軟體技術,只要技術為證明是成熟的,都會在JVM裡面見到其蹤影。JDK的每一次更新,從內部到核心類庫,JVM都會及時引入這些最新的技術或者演演算法,這便是技術傳承意義之所在。隨著雲端計算、巨量資料、人工智慧等最新技術的發展,Java 技術生態圈也日益龐大, JVM與底層平臺以及與其他程式語言和技術的互動、交織日益深入,這些都離不開對JVM內部機制的深入理解。

PDF主要目錄大綱介紹:

  • 第1章Java虛擬機器器概述
  • 第2章Java執行引擎工作原理:方法呼叫
  • 第3章Java資料結構與物件導向
  • 第4章Java位元組碼實戰
  • 第5章常數池解析
  • 第6章類變數解析
  • 第7章Java棧幀
  • 第8章類方法解析
  • 第9章執行引擎
  • 第10章類的生命週期

愛了,3174頁實戰pdf集錦:Redis+多執行緒+Dubbo+JVM+kafka+MySQL

05—kafka實戰

Kafka 起初是由 Linkedin 公司採用 Scala 語言開發的 個多分割區、多副本且基於 ZooKeeper協調的分散式訊息系統,現已被捐獻給 Apache 基金會 目前 Kafka 已經定位為一個分散式流式處理平臺,它以高吞吐、可持久化、可水平擴充套件、支援流資料處理等多種特性而被廣泛使用。目前越來越多的開源分散式處理系統如 loudera Storm Spark Flink 等都支援與 Kafka 整合

PDF主要目錄大綱介紹:

  • 第1章初識Kafka
  • 第2章生產者
  • 第3章消費者
  • 第4章主題與分割區
  • 第5章紀錄檔儲存
  • 第6章深入伺服器端
  • 第7章深入使用者端
  • 第8章可靠性探究
  • 第9章Kafka應用
  • 第10章Kafka監控
  • 第11章高階應用
  • 第12章Kafka與Spark的整合

愛了,3174頁實戰pdf集錦:Redis+多執行緒+Dubbo+JVM+kafka+MySQL

06—高效能MySQL

本書是MySQL領域的經典之作,擁有廣泛的影響力。第3版更新了大量的內容,不但涵蓋了最新MySQL 5.5版本的新特性,也講述了關於固態盤、高可延伸性設計和雲端計算環境下的資料庫相關的新內容,原有的基準測試和效能優化部分也做了大量的擴充套件和補充。

PDF主要目錄大綱介紹:

  • 第1章MySQL架構與歷史
  • 第2章MySQL基準測試
  • 第3章伺服器效能剖析
  • 第4章Schema與資料型別優化
  • 第5章建立高效能的索引
  • 第6章查詢效能優化
  • 第7章MySQL高階特性
  • 第8章優化伺服器設定
  • 第9章作業系統和硬體優化
  • 第10章複製
  • 第11章可延伸的MySQL
  • 第12章高可用性
  • 第13章雲端的MySQL
  • 第14章應用層優化
  • 第15章備份與恢復
  • 第16章MySQL使用者工具

愛了,3174頁實戰pdf集錦:Redis+多執行緒+Dubbo+JVM+kafka+MySQL

07—實戰Nginx取代Apache的高效能Web伺服器

在國內,已經有新浪部落格、新浪播客、網易新聞、六間房、56.com、Discuz!官方論壇、 水木社群、豆瓣、YUPOO相簿、海內SNS、迅雷線上等多家網站使用Nginx 作為Web伺服器或反向代理伺服器。

  • 第1章Nginx簡介
  • 第2章Nginx伺服器的安裝與設定
  • 第3章Nginx的基本設定與優化
  • 第4章Nginx與PHP(FastCGI)的安裝、設定與優化
  • 第5章Nginx與JSP、ASP.NET. Perl的安裝與設定
  • 第6章Nginx HTTP負載均衡和反向代理的設定與優化
  • 第7章Nginx的Rewrite規則與範例
  • 第8章Nginx模組開發
  • 第9章Nginx的Web快取服務與新浪網的開源NCACHE模組
  • 第10章Nginx在國內知名網站中的應用案例
  • 第11章Nginx的非典型應用範例
  • 第12章Nginx的核心模組
  • 第13章Nginx的標準HTTP模組
  • 第14章Nginx的其他HTTP模組
  • 第15章Nginx的郵件模組

愛了,3174頁實戰pdf集錦:Redis+多執行緒+Dubbo+JVM+kafka+MySQL